Description

Hydrazine, (2-Fluoro-5-Methylphenyl)- (9Ci) is a specialized aromatic hydrazine derivative, identified by CAS NO 293330-02-6. This compound serves as a critical high-purity building block in advanced organic synthesis, enabling the introduction of a functionalized phenylhydrazine moiety. It is primarily required by R&D and production chemists in the pharmaceutical and agrochemical sectors for the development of novel active ingredients and fine chemicals.

Basic Information

Product Name Hydrazine, (2-Fluoro-5-Methylphenyl)- (9Ci)
CAS No. 293330-02-6
Molecular Formula C7H9FN2
Molecular Weight 140.16 g/mol
Synonyms (2-Fluoro-5-methylphenyl)hydrazine; 1-(2-Fluoro-5-methylphenyl)hydrazine; 2-Fluoro-5-methylphenylhydrazine; 2-Fluoro-5-methyl-1-phenylhydrazine; o-Fluoro-p-tolylhydrazine; Hydrazine, (2-fluoro-5-methylphenyl)-; 293330-02-6

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). Due to its nature as an easily oxidized compound, it is recommended to store under an inert atmosphere (e.g., nitrogen or argon) for long-term stability. Keep away from heat, sparks, and open flames.
